In celebration of the Hilton Melbourne Little Queen Street (HMLQS) partnership with Melbourne Food And Wine Festival (MFWF), the hotel will be serving up delectable menu items and deliciously drinkable cocktails requested by the food festival’s star chefs.
A series of dishes and cocktail favourites from the chefs who will be here for the festival – Sarah Cicolini from Roman trattoria, Santo Palato, Neil Perry from award-winning Double Bay restaurant, Margaret and Dan Hong, Executive Chef of Merivale Group (Mr Wong’s, Ms G’s, Queen Chow’s, MuMu4u, Establishment Sydney) will be on offer throughout the festival.
HMLQS’ MFWF inspired menu items will be available from Thursday, 14 to Sunday, 24 March, and will include:
- Cicolini’s favourite lunchtime snack – an Italian piadina filled with parma ham, truffle mayo and rocket ($24)
- Dan Hong-inspired ebi fry sandwich – panko-crusted prawns cutlets sandwiched in a fluffy brioche bun, layered with shredded cabbage and a rich tartare sauce ($10)
- For those who like to enjoy delicious treats (or a late night snack) without leaving their rooms, HMLQS’ in room menu will include Hong’s dish – Wagyu Jjapaguri, a Korean noodle dish made by with combination of Stone Axe Full Blood Wagyu oyster blade steak, MBS 9+, egg noodles, black bean oyster sauce, sesame oil and spring onion ($48)
- Providing the perfect accompaniment, HMLQS will be serving up Cicolini’s favourite tipple, a Dirty Dry Gin Martini – Dutch Rules Australian Gin, smoked olive brine, Sicilian olives, stirred and served up ($24)
- Hong’s concoction, a Yuzu Highball, featuring Japanese rice vodka, Yuzushu, red shiso, shaken, served long over ice ($24)
- Perry’s Margaret-inspired, Victorian Negroni – Melbourne Gin Co, Campari, Soma Victorian Vermouth, stirred, served over ice ($24)
- To finish, Cicolini’s salted caramel fig crostata – roasted figs in salted caramel with ricotta wrapped in Hilton’s own leavened dough and garnished with fresh fruit will provide the perfect sweet end to the evening ($12)
